Overcome My Fear Of Flying
Eva Marklund
?Karen closed her eyes and leaned back into the seat. As the engines started, and the plane started taxiing down the runway, that all to familiar dread completely enveloped her. The feeling of death being imminent. The powerless feeling of not being able to remove herself from what her mind perceived to be a life threatening experience. The feeling of total despair with her body shaking, sweating, and out of control.
Karen decided she would never put herself through this ever again.
Years went by and Karen drove many thousands of miles to family gatherings, reunions, and once to a job interview 3100 miles away?
Her fear was so strong, and, in her mind, (and most importantly) so justified, she never even sought help.
Then, in October of 2002, she won a very important award for her company and was expected to fly from Los Angeles to London to receive her honor, or she would face professional consequences.
It was fly or die. (professionally speaking)
After doing a lot of research, (after all, Karen's field is research analysis) she decided, even though skeptical, to try one of the new therapy methods born out of research into the bodies deepest levels. The Energy Level?
These therapy methods use points on the skin, scientifically proven to have an effect on the brain, and thus your brain chemicals, (the chemicals that causes you to feel afraid) while mentally tuning into the problem.
While it does sound strange and far out, clinical studies actually prove, with scientific methods, the difference in the brain before and after doing the therapy.
But let's go back to Karen and her situation?let's jump right into her session using Emotional Freedoms Techniques? (Widely recognized for it's remarkable efficacy for fears and phobias)
?Ok, Karen, what is the absolute worst thing about flying?? ?The feeling of being pressed into the seat as we accelerate down the runway. I just know there is no way out. I can't get off this thing.?
?Ah, so on a scale from 0 to 10, zero meaning no fear at all, and 10 meaning maximum amount of fear, or discomfort, what number would you get if you were to think about it now?? ?Oh, about a 9.5?
(Now, we find the words that Karen would use to describe the feeling/sensation, and we use those words as Karen is directed to tap on 9 specific acupuncture points- the result of tapping the points while focusing on the fear is a total neutralization of the fear.)
After tapping all the points Karen is asked to tune into the exact same scenario and rate her discomfort. ?Oh, about a 5.?
So it went from a 9.5 to a 5.
Karen and I went through the tapping again, with a slightly different set of words.
?OK, so now if you were t think about going down the runway, not being able to get off the plane,,,, how does it feel now, on a scale from one to ten??
?Uhm. I don't know?. It seems I can't find it anymore? I have a hard time focusing on it? ?OK. Good.
(This very typical by the way. The person having a hard time focusing on what just a few minutes ago sent them into sheer panic)
?So in your mind, briefly go through a flying experience and tell me anything that feels uncomfortable. Now, remember, we WANT to know if anything at all feels even a tad uncomfortable?
Karen went through the flying experience several times, each time finding a piece that felt unsafe, or frightening.
We applied the method to every single item, until the intensity was a zero. Together we "tapped" on the fear of being in an enclosed space, the fear of making a fool of herself by "freaking out" on the plane, the fear of turbulence, the fear of having no control, and the fear of ever having to feel such panic ever again...
Let's skip forward to the end of the session:
?OK, Karen, I want you to close you eyes and imagine the entire flying experience, from the point of thinking about the trip, getting the tickets, all the way through landing. Take your time, and if you find anything at all that feels anything less than comfortable, let me know.?
Karen is quiet for quite some time. Going through the flying experience in her mind. ?No, I don't feel anything that doesn't feel OK?
?OK, fine. Why don't you go through that again, and TRY to find something to get fearful about. Imagine bad weather- the plane tilting, dipping and free falling? imagine other fearful passengers screaming, imagine the worst case scenario?? I'm actually trying to find something to scare her about, to make sure we have not missed anything.
(To my knowledge there is NO other method that is so assured of success that they will actually TRY to make the client afraid to ensure that nothing was missed?
Most methods will have you focus on good feeling things, or to try to mentally avoid your flight, or to assure you that you have a support group on the ground tracking your flight, but this method is SO effective we WANT to have you search for anything still there that can possibly bother you when you fly, and then we will neutralize it, so that when you fly there will be NOTHING that feels frightening to you.
?No. It feels REALLY good.?
?Ok, fine?
After having Karen go through the flying experience again, asking her to really TRY to find something to be afraid about, and her not finding even one thing, our work is complete.
This is a very typical session to completely and permanently release the fear of flying.
Is it always this easy?
What you have read is a very typical session using EFT. Most cases of fear of flying can be completely resolved in l to 2 sessions or less. It matters not so much how long the fear has been there, or how intense it is. What can matter is if the person has many other fears, and a high level of general anxiety. In those cases, a few more sessions may be needed.
However, even those diagnosed with GAD (generalized anxiety disorder) can easily release their fear of flying. In most cases within 2-3 sessions.
